Zusammenfassung

Der Begriff der Modellierung ist gerade im angewandten Bereich wenig exakt bestimmt und reicht von der einfachen Regressionsbeziehung bis zu komplizierten numerischen Modellen. In der angewandten Meteorologie (Agrarmeteorologie, Hydrometeorologie) sind einfache analytische Modelle weit verbreitet, wobei der Bestimmung der Verdunstung eine besondere Rolle zukommt. Das vorliegende Kapitel soll verschiedene Arten der Modellierung beginnend von einfachen analytischen Verfahren bis zur Berücksichtigung des bodennahen Energie- und Stofftransportes in numerischen Modellen behandeln und dabei die spezifischen Probleme herausstellen. Ein wesentliches Augenmerk wird auf die Anwendung der Modelle im heterogenen Gelände gelegt, wobei der Problematik der Flächenmittelung ein eigenes Kapitel gewidmet ist.
